Before we tag the release, one note on the Wordlattice generator: the fill solver's backtracking limits were retuned after the Hapney puzzle set exposed pathological grids. The new bounds trade a slight increase in average solve time for far fewer timeouts. Please confirm the build picks up the updated config, since stale caches bit us last cycle. The constants in question are these.

tuning table, hafog-bahaf:
QUOTAS = {
    "praion": 144,
    "briax": 906,
    "silwyn": 451,
}

Ticket: Drift detected — Pinefold reminder job

The clinic appointment reminder job on Pinefold prod no longer matches the committed config. Send window and batch size were changed manually, likely during last week's quiet-hours complaint. Reminders still go out, but earlier than documented. Please confirm patients in the western region aren't affected, then re-apply source control. The values currently running in prod are below.

settings of yageg-yahap:
[gorael]
team = olieth
access_code = ac_941d74
owner = brieth.aldiel
host = gorael.tolvaqio.internal
port = 6379
peer = briwyn.urlaqtech.internal
salt = 116e6622
pin = 1957

**Q: What do I do during a fire drill roll call?**

When the alarm sounds at Calderwell House, reception staff must take the visitor logbook to Assembly Point C in the Birchway car park. Read out each signed-in visitor's name and confirm they are present before the warden, Ms. Tarrent, closes the count. Do not re-enter until the all-clear. To unlock the logbook cabinet behind the desk, use the following pass code.

badge for fahip-bajef: bdg-WNLYHN-07844109

Facilities Ticket #—

Request: Pop-up office at the Brindleford Expo, Hall 4. Nollix Systems booth needs a lockable back office for laptops and demo units from Tuesday setup through teardown. Venue has installed a keypad cabinet door; cleaning access arranged via hall management. Assistants staffing the booth should use the door code provided below.

turnstile pass: bdg-PD-2